I filled out applications repeatedly before I finally got a call (my manager said there were 26 applications on file...) The interview was private between me, the hiring manager and the store manager (but I know they'll sometimes choose to do group interviews instead). I wore a nice skirt and blouse. The overall vibe of the interview was professional but laid back. There weren't any difficult questions. The company requires a background check and drug test.

Question 1
My hiring manager handed me a Sharpie and told me to sell it to her.
